COMMENT
Off-target activity is suggested based on the anti-proliferative activity in cells lacking HIF-2α. It would be helpful if an off-target (e.g. GPCR/kinase panel) was performed. Sep 24 2020 - 9:52am

DESCRIPTION
PT2399 is a first-in-class, orally available, small molecule inhibitor of HIF-2 that selectively disrupts the heterodimerization of HIF-2α with HIF-1β. PT2399 displays potent antitumor activity in vivo
